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Bivane Dam.
- Visit early in the morning to enjoy the peaceful atmosphere and stunning sunrise views.
- Bring picnic essentials and enjoy a meal by the water, taking in the beautiful surroundings.
- Don't forget your camera; the scenic views and wildlife make for great photo opportunities.
- Check local fishing regulations if you plan to fish, as permits may be required.
- Make sure to wear comfortable shoes if you plan to hike the trails around the dam.
